So, I have identified connectors before, and I know almost certainly this is a JAE connector, as there is “JAE F” molded into it. It has 24 pins, 14 power and 10 signal lines, so dual pin gauges. It plugs into a Honda Adaptive Damper module, which I am trying to replicate. The pitch of the power pins is 3.0mm by my measurement. Thank you to anyone who might be able to help!

I’m no MechE, but I wouldn’t consider it except for a heavy track car. Having built the bottom end of an L15B7 engine (the one in the Si and CRV), the tolerances are super close. Best to use the oil the engine was designed around, in this case 0W-20. 500 miles a week is a good amount, but I believe the oil dilution is less severe the longer your commute is. The oil gets up to temp and the gas evaporates better from what I’ve heard.

My anecdotal evidence from my 2020 Sport Hatch - Oil dilution has only cropped up badly once, after a 100F track night recently, my oil was over the max line. The Maintenance Minder screen is somewhat right, but to be on the safe side I change my oil at 50% usually, or about 6500 miles of driving. This is plenty fine, I’ve been using Castro’s GTX and Motul Eco-Lite 0W-20 since the first change. No engine harshness besides the deafening injector noise. I wouldn’t worry about oil dilution unless you drive your car for 5000+ in between oil changes. It’s dependent on motor really, but the gas kills the oil before it gets old in my experience with my car
